US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"dream without boundaries"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to express the idea of having limitless aspirations or creativity, often in motivational or inspirational contexts. Example: "In her art, she encourages everyone to dream without boundaries and explore their true potential."

Expert writing Tips

Best practice

Use "dream without boundaries" in situations where you want to encourage people to think big and not be limited by conventional thinking.

Common error

Avoid using "dream without boundaries" in contexts that require practical limitations or realistic planning, as it can undermine the seriousness of the situation. It's better to adapt the phrase or choose another that acknowledges the constraints involved.

Linguistic Context

The phrase "dream without boundaries" functions primarily as a motivational expression. It uses the verb 'dream' in an aspirational sense, modified by the prepositional phrase 'without boundaries' to emphasize the absence of limitations. Ludwig AI confirms that it is correct and usable in written English.

FAQs

What does it mean to "dream without boundaries"?

To "dream without boundaries" means to imagine or aspire to achieve goals without being limited by conventional thinking, practical considerations, or perceived obstacles. It encourages a mindset of limitless possibility.

How can I use "dream without boundaries" in a sentence?

You can use "dream without boundaries" to inspire creativity or encourage ambitious goal-setting, such as: "In her art, she encourages everyone to dream without boundaries and explore their true potential."

What are some alternatives to "dream without boundaries"?

Alternatives to "dream without boundaries" include phrases like "imagine freely", "aspire limitlessly", or "have boundless dreams", depending on the specific nuance you want to convey.

When is it appropriate to use the phrase "dream without boundaries"?

It is appropriate to use "dream without boundaries" in contexts where you want to promote innovation, encourage creativity, or inspire people to pursue ambitious goals, especially in fields like art, entrepreneurship, or personal development. Avoid it in contexts requiring concrete limitations.
